Output 7572cd2fb29c60610204d68ba2914038addbfd656b1cf9c04d559656d6f2f0f9:0

value
26816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e867115f602c31e317bc2a180c26bf0551f89b65 OP_EQUAL
address
3NsrAL2wKTDq8hUGfMgB2oNEkS6TtEy4yp
transaction
7572cd2fb29c60610204d68ba2914038addbfd656b1cf9c04d559656d6f2f0f9
spent
true